Six Eccentric Activities in London
Those that live in London will be well acquainted with what their district offers. However, there is a wealth of activities open to everyone if their prepared to search and do a little bit of travelling. However, those looking for a quirkier activity, here’s a list of unique experiences London offers that aren’t to be missed.
Ripley’s Believe It Or Not
Piccadilly Circus is one of the most attractive destinations in the whole of London. However, for an experience that’s hard to beat, take a look around Ripley’s Believe It Or Not. From eye-catching exhibits to a laser race, this is one venue perfect for children and their parents.
Pub Tour Beers of Ages
Those with a penchant for real ale can’t afford to miss the Pub Tour Beers of Ages in the East End. If you’re staying in one of London’s hostels and considering a unique evening activity, this isn’t to be missed.
Hampstead Heath’s Swimming Ponds
When the temperature rises to an uncomfortable degree, taking a cooling dip is most welcomed. The swimming ponds of Hampstead Heath are perfect for cooling off throughout the summer months.
Clapham’s Gourmet Toast
Fancy a bite but don’t fancy mundane pasta, burgers or salads? Why not sample gourmet toast. With freshly baked bread, portions to fill even the most ravenous appetite and delicious ingredients, the gourmet toast of Clapham are perfect for combating hunger.
Umbrella Shopping
London does suffer from showers. You’ll need an umbrella to shelter you when the heavens open. Those with a discerning sense of style may find the umbrellas at St. James & Sons right up their alley. With a heritage that stretches all the way back to 1830, you’ll immediately see why when you see the designs.
Death and Dining
Have you grown weary of the same old dining experience? Les Trois Garcon in Shoreditch is one dining experience that you won’t soon forget. The delicious menu is complemented by a decor filled with stuffed animals. The restaurant may not be to everyone’s taste, but it cannot be denied that a unique dining experience is served every day.
Those looking for an eccentric experience in our nation’s capital should take the time to enjoy one, or all of these activities.
